The MULTICOMP PRO 45° Conical Soldering Tip is a precision tool designed for use with the MP740070 50W mini soldering iron. Featuring a 1.2mm diameter conical tip set at a 45-degree angle, this soldering tip ensures precise soldering work for intricate electronic projects.
With its integrated heater, the tip delivers quick heat-up times and consistent performance, making it ideal for detailed work such as PCB assembly or component soldering. The conical shape allows for precision application of solder in tight spaces where accuracy is paramount.
Made to exacting standards, this tip is durable and designed to match the specifications of the MULTICOMP PRO MP740070 soldering iron, ensuring compatibility and reliable performance. Whether you're a professional or a hobbyist, this soldering tip provides the control and precision needed for high-quality work.
Additional Information:
Tip/Nozzle Width: 1.2mm
Tip/Nozzle Style: 45° Conical
Use With: Multicomp MP740070 50W Mini Soldering Iron
Power Rating: 50W
